Our verdict is Uncertain significance. The variant received 2 ACMG points: 2P and 0B. PM2
The NM_144683.4(DHRS13):c.823G>A(p.Glu275Lys) variant causes a missense change. The variant allele was found at a frequency of 0.0000062 in 1,613,812 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
DHRS13 (HGNC:28326): (dehydrogenase/reductase 13) Predicted to enable NADP-retinol dehydrogenase activity. Predicted to be involved in retinal metabolic process. Located in membrane. [provided by Alliance of Genome Resources, Apr 2022]
